الفرق بين المراجعتين لصفحة: «Python/bytes/rjust»
أنشأ الصفحة ب'<noinclude>{{DISPLAYTITLE:الدالة <code>bytes.rjust()</code> في بايثون}}</noinclude> تعيد الدالة نسخة من البيانات الثنائي...' |
ط استبدال النص - ':الدالة' ب':التابع' |
||
(2 مراجعات متوسطة بواسطة نفس المستخدم غير معروضة) | |||
سطر 1: | سطر 1: | ||
<noinclude>{{DISPLAYTITLE: | <noinclude>{{DISPLAYTITLE:التابع <code>bytes.rjust()</code> في بايثون}}</noinclude> | ||
يعيد التابع نسخة من البيانات الثنائية مزاحة نحو اليمين ضمن تسلسل ذي طول محدّد. | |||
== البنية العامة == | == البنية العامة == | ||
<syntaxhighlight lang="python3"> | <syntaxhighlight lang="python3"> | ||
bytes.rjust(width[, fillbyte]) | |||
</syntaxhighlight> | </syntaxhighlight> | ||
سطر 14: | سطر 14: | ||
=== <code>fillbyte</code> === | === <code>fillbyte</code> === | ||
يحدّد هذا المعامل البايتات التي | يحدّد هذا المعامل البايتات التي سيستخدمها التابع لإجراء عملية الإزاحة، ويأخذ هذا المعامل قيمة افتراضية هي المسافة البيضاء في ترميز ASCII. | ||
== القيمة المعادة == | == القيمة المعادة == | ||
يعيد التابع نسخة من البيانات الثنائية مزاحة نحو اليمين ضمن تسلسل ذي عرض محدّد، وتزاح الحروف باستخدام البايتات التي يحدّدها المستخدم. | |||
إذا كانت القيمة المحدّدة للمعامل <code>width</code> أقل من أو تساوي القيمة المعادة من <code>len(s)</code>، | إذا كانت القيمة المحدّدة للمعامل <code>width</code> أقل من أو تساوي القيمة المعادة من <code>len(s)</code>، فسيعيد التابع التسلسل الأصلي. | ||
== أمثلة == | == أمثلة == | ||
يبين المثال التالي النتائج المعادة من تطبيق | يبين المثال التالي النتائج المعادة من تطبيق التابع: | ||
<syntaxhighlight lang="python3"> | <syntaxhighlight lang="python3"> | ||
سطر 36: | سطر 36: | ||
== انظر أيضًا == | == انظر أيضًا == | ||
* [[Python/bytes|البايتات في بايثون.]] | * [[Python/bytes|البايتات في بايثون.]] | ||
*التابع <code>[[Python/bytes/center|bytes.center()]]</code>: تعيد الدالة البيانات الثنائية مزاحة نحو الوسط ضمن تسلسل يحمل طولًا يحدّده المستخدم. | |||
*التابع <code>[[Python/bytes/ljust|bytes.ljust()]]</code>: تعيد الدالة نسخة من البيانات الثنائية مزاحة نحو اليسار ضمن تسلسل ذي طول محدّد. | |||
== مصادر == | == مصادر == | ||
* [https://docs.python.org/3/library/stdtypes.html#bytes.rjust قسم rjust في صفحة Types في توثيق بايثون الرسمي.] | * [https://docs.python.org/3/library/stdtypes.html#bytes.rjust قسم rjust في صفحة Types في توثيق بايثون الرسمي.] | ||
[[تصنيف:Python]] | [[تصنيف:Python]] | ||
[[تصنيف:Python | [[تصنيف:Python Method]] | ||
[[تصنيف:Python | [[تصنيف:Python Types]] | ||
[[تصنيف:Python Bytes]] |
المراجعة الحالية بتاريخ 11:59، 10 يونيو 2018
يعيد التابع نسخة من البيانات الثنائية مزاحة نحو اليمين ضمن تسلسل ذي طول محدّد.
البنية العامة
bytes.rjust(width[, fillbyte])
المعاملات
width
يحدّد هذا المعامل طول التسلسل المعاد.
fillbyte
يحدّد هذا المعامل البايتات التي سيستخدمها التابع لإجراء عملية الإزاحة، ويأخذ هذا المعامل قيمة افتراضية هي المسافة البيضاء في ترميز ASCII.
القيمة المعادة
يعيد التابع نسخة من البيانات الثنائية مزاحة نحو اليمين ضمن تسلسل ذي عرض محدّد، وتزاح الحروف باستخدام البايتات التي يحدّدها المستخدم.
إذا كانت القيمة المحدّدة للمعامل width
أقل من أو تساوي القيمة المعادة من len(s)
، فسيعيد التابع التسلسل الأصلي.
أمثلة
يبين المثال التالي النتائج المعادة من تطبيق التابع:
>>> company = b'Hsoub'
>>> company.rjust(13)
b' Hsoub'
>>> company.rjust(13, b'=')
b'========Hsoub'
>>> company.rjust(5, b'=')
b'Hsoub'
انظر أيضًا
- البايتات في بايثون.
- التابع
bytes.center()
: تعيد الدالة البيانات الثنائية مزاحة نحو الوسط ضمن تسلسل يحمل طولًا يحدّده المستخدم. - التابع
bytes.ljust()
: تعيد الدالة نسخة من البيانات الثنائية مزاحة نحو اليسار ضمن تسلسل ذي طول محدّد.